About the role

The goal of the Groups Field Assistant is to support the delivery of world-leading groups programs in country, by focusing on participant experience

Role and responsibilities:

  • Supporting the Program Manager and Co-ordinator  in the running of group programs.
  • Assisting with project work including planning sessions
  • Managing the groups on a day to day basis, ensuring they have a positive experience
  • Interacting with local partners for certain activities
  • Delivering presentations and training relevant to the project activities
  • Acting as an enthusiastic role model for participants  and providing guidance and mentorship
  • Working with the team to ensure the program operates to a high standard and all health and safety protocols are followed
